com.silverpeas.delegatednews.web
Class DelegatedNewsServiceMock

java.lang.Object
  extended by com.silverpeas.delegatednews.web.DelegatedNewsServiceMock
All Implemented Interfaces:
DelegatedNewsService

@Named
public class DelegatedNewsServiceMock
extends Object
implements DelegatedNewsService


Constructor Summary
DelegatedNewsServiceMock()
           
 
Method Summary
 void deleteDelegatedNews(int pubId)
           
 List<DelegatedNews> getAllDelegatedNews()
           
 List<DelegatedNews> getAllValidDelegatedNews()
           
 DelegatedNews getDelegatedNews(int pubId)
           
 DelegatedNewsService getDelegatedNewsService()
           
 void refuseDelegatedNews(int pubId, String validatorId, String motive)
           
 void submitNews(String id, com.silverpeas.SilverpeasContent news, String lastUpdaterId, org.silverpeas.date.Period visibilityPeriod, String userId)
           
 void updateDateDelegatedNews(int pubId, Date dateHourBegin, Date dateHourEnd)
           
 void updateDelegatedNews(String id, com.silverpeas.SilverpeasContent news, String updaterId, org.silverpeas.date.Period visibilityPeriod)
           
 DelegatedNews updateOrderDelegatedNews(int pubId, int newsOrder)
           
 void validateDelegatedNews(int pubId, String validatorId)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DelegatedNewsServiceMock

public DelegatedNewsServiceMock()
Method Detail

getDelegatedNewsService

public DelegatedNewsService getDelegatedNewsService()

submitNews

public void submitNews(String id,
                       com.silverpeas.SilverpeasContent news,
                       String lastUpdaterId,
                       org.silverpeas.date.Period visibilityPeriod,
                       String userId)
Specified by:
submitNews in interface DelegatedNewsService

getDelegatedNews

public DelegatedNews getDelegatedNews(int pubId)
Specified by:
getDelegatedNews in interface DelegatedNewsService

getAllDelegatedNews

public List<DelegatedNews> getAllDelegatedNews()
Specified by:
getAllDelegatedNews in interface DelegatedNewsService

getAllValidDelegatedNews

public List<DelegatedNews> getAllValidDelegatedNews()
Specified by:
getAllValidDelegatedNews in interface DelegatedNewsService

validateDelegatedNews

public void validateDelegatedNews(int pubId,
                                  String validatorId)
Specified by:
validateDelegatedNews in interface DelegatedNewsService

refuseDelegatedNews

public void refuseDelegatedNews(int pubId,
                                String validatorId,
                                String motive)
Specified by:
refuseDelegatedNews in interface DelegatedNewsService

updateDateDelegatedNews

public void updateDateDelegatedNews(int pubId,
                                    Date dateHourBegin,
                                    Date dateHourEnd)
Specified by:
updateDateDelegatedNews in interface DelegatedNewsService

updateDelegatedNews

public void updateDelegatedNews(String id,
                                com.silverpeas.SilverpeasContent news,
                                String updaterId,
                                org.silverpeas.date.Period visibilityPeriod)
Specified by:
updateDelegatedNews in interface DelegatedNewsService

deleteDelegatedNews

public void deleteDelegatedNews(int pubId)
Specified by:
deleteDelegatedNews in interface DelegatedNewsService

updateOrderDelegatedNews

public DelegatedNews updateOrderDelegatedNews(int pubId,
                                              int newsOrder)
Specified by:
updateOrderDelegatedNews in interface DelegatedNewsService


Copyright © 2016 Silverpeas. All Rights Reserved.